Hatton Animal Rescue Foundation's Sanctuary Forever Foster Program: The goal of the Forever Foster program is to provide loving and safe homes for older, special needs or palliative care animals. A Forever Foster pet is usually a senior pet or a pet with medical needs that generally would not be adopted otherwise – these are the unfortunate ones who are overlooked at animal shelters and are often the first to be euthanized. While you provide a safe home environment (food, toys, attention and, of course, LOVE) for one of our sweet animals, Hatton Animal Rescue is committed to covering ALL medical costs for the deserving animal that you welcome in. Why commit to becoming a Forever Foster? Of course, the first reason is that these special animals deserve to live out their lives in comfort and with love. Second, Forever Foster parents will be the first to tell you that the love these pets return is unconditional, and that it is extremely fulfilling to provide special care. The love you provide goes a long way as your forever foster is able to live out his/her best life.
